THREE CAUSE ROUTES

What looks like condensation could be something else.

01

Cyclic condensation

Moisture occurs around dew point times and can dry out again between cycles.

02

Leakage

Rainwater, pipes or connections cause a local or recurring moisture load.

03

Climate and building physics

Ventilation, cold bridges, insulation and production moisture require a broader measure.

TECHNICAL FOLLOW-UP ROUTE

From observation to demonstrable selection.

The scan organizes the initial information. A real system proposal is only created after the cause, substrate and conditions have been determined.

  1. 01Assess intake and scan results
  2. 02Measure temperature, RH and dew point
  3. 03Exclude leaks and permanent sources of moisture
  4. 04Check the substrate and existing layers
  5. 05Carry out a representative test area
  6. 06Determine work plan, layer structure and maintenance

Condensation buffering. No hidden moisture problem.

Permanently wet surfaces, active leakage and insufficient ventilation are not 'solved' with a coating. PolyShield makes that boundary visible in advance and can outsource specialist research or preparatory work to a partner under technical direction.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S

The technical boundaries are clear in advance.

Is an anti-condensation coating always the solution?+

No. First, leakage, permanent moisture, ventilation, surface temperature and building use must be investigated. The coating can only fulfill a buffering function in an appropriate cyclic condensation situation.

Does the coating replace insulation or ventilation?+

No. Insulation, ventilation and process control remain separate building physics measures. The system choice follows from measurements and a location recording.

Can the coating be sprayed?+

Airless can be interesting for large, accessible surfaces, if the current product documentation, shielding and building environment support this.
